Output 582936269b7264c3cd7a3ff78587e411ebbde848b61b7bd0c7c1acaa7d8c3eef:0

value
949576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829d6cf50aeb96a1a9eae70896b34dcc92c51977 OP_EQUAL
address
3DbeMc3uz22VuhZvAdtgAgQG6mXugUWLWZ
transaction
582936269b7264c3cd7a3ff78587e411ebbde848b61b7bd0c7c1acaa7d8c3eef
spent
true